I’ve transcribed Liverpool Revisited to the best of my abilities.

As someone who picks everything to pieces and complains about them repeating lyrics in verses, I was drawn to this one because until the very end it almost managed to be a Manics song that doesn’t repeat a single line or have a chorus. The rarest of things.

As I wake to a sunset
The light dances on the Mersey
And I think of the 96
As the tears fall down on me

There is courage, there is pride
You can see it in your eyes
Fight for justice, fight for life
There are angels in these skies

As the night falls around me
I see joy and devotion
These times will never leave
Like the rain on the ocean

There is dignity and pride
There is poetry and life
There are ghosts within these stones
There’s defiance in these bones

And all the hatred they tried to throw at you
And yet you stayed so strong
Yeah, all that hatred, it never was the truth
So keep keeping on

This is forever
We’ll never leave you now
This is forever
We’ll never leave you now
